Gratex Industries Limited has filed an initial disclosure with BSE confirming that it is NOT classified as a Large Corporate under SEBI guidelines. The company reports outstanding borrowing of just Rs. 0.17 Crore as of 31st March 2026, which is well below the threshold for Large Corporate classification. No credit rating is applicable given the minimal debt level. The disclosure follows SEBI Circular SEBI/HO/DDHS/CIR/P/2018/144 and is part of routine regulatory compliance. This filing is informational and confirms the company's smaller size relative to regulatory thresholds.
No direct impact on shareholders as this is a routine compliance disclosure confirming the company falls below the Large Corporate threshold. The small borrowing amount (Rs. 0.17 Crore) indicates conservative debt levels.
